Bug Description
As described above. I've booted my convertible laptop in tent mode. After the login the screen orinetation is getting wrong. Top is on the bottom but the control-orinetation (mouse and touch-screen) is the right one. So if I for example want to open the Gnome Shell I have to click in the bottom left corner, but the button is shown in the top right corner. Even if I turn back the screen in "normal" mode the roientation keeps to be wrong.
This bug doesn't appear in a wayland session.
